boffin
Meanings
Plural: boffins
Noun
- (British slang) a scientist or technician engaged in military research
- An engineer or scientist, especially one engaged in technological or military research.

Origin / Etymology
Origin unknown; a number of possible etymologies have been suggested, but no conclusive evidence exists.
One strong theory conjectures a connection from the "Mr. Boffins" of English novels, such as in Dickens' Our Mutual Friend.
